libbpf: Don't attempt to load unused subprog as an entry-point BPF program

If BPF code contains unused BPF subprogram and there are no other subprogram
calls (which can realistically happen in real-world applications given
sufficiently smart Clang code optimizations), libbpf will erroneously assume
that subprograms are entry-point programs and will attempt to load them with
UNSPEC program type.

Fix by not relying on subcall instructions and rather detect it based on the
structure of BPF object's sections.
